| +def GetGlobalVSMacroEnv(vs_version): |
| + """Get a dict of variables mapping internal VS macro names to their gyp |
| + equivalents. Returns all variables that are independent of the target.""" |
| + env = {} |
| + # '$(VSInstallDir)' and '$(VCInstallDir)' are available when and only when |
| + # Visual Studio is actually installed. |
| + if vs_version.Path(): |
| + env['$(VSInstallDir)'] = vs_version.Path() |
| + env['$(VCInstallDir)'] = os.path.join(vs_version.Path(), 'VC') + '\\' |
| + # Chromium uses DXSDK_DIR in include/lib paths, but it may or may not be |
| + # set. This happens when the SDK is sync'd via src-internal, rather than |
| + # by typical end-user installation of the SDK. If it's not set, we don't |
| + # want to leave the unexpanded variable in the path, so simply strip it. |
| + dxsdk_dir = _FindDirectXInstallation() |
| + env['$(DXSDK_DIR)'] = dxsdk_dir if dxsdk_dir else '' |
| + # Try to find an installation location for the Windows DDK by checking |
| + # the WDK_DIR environment variable, may be None. |
| + env['$(WDK_DIR)'] = os.environ.get('WDK_DIR', '') |
| + return env |
